Confirmation and validation process

The purpose of these text messages is to ensure that the selected applicants acknowledge their preselection and proceed with the necessary steps to validate their Npower records. The validation process is crucial for updating the beneficiaries’ database accurately.

Steps to confirm status and update Npower records

To confirm their status and update their Npower records, the applicants need to follow these steps:

  1. Open the link provided in the text message. The applicants can use either of the two links mentioned: validation.nasims.ng or http://kir.am/6/02KD5tPotHCl. Both links direct to the same website and serve the same purpose. Upon accessing the webpage, the applicants should carefully read the provided information and click on the “Accept” button to proceed.
  2. Enter the Npower ID, which can be found by logging into their NASIMS Dashboard at https://nasims.gov.ng. In case the applicants have forgotten their password, they can click on the “Forgot Password” option and follow the necessary steps to recover it. Once logged in, they should copy and paste their Npower ID, which follows the format NPWR/2020/xxxxxx.
  3. Provide their Bank Verification Number (BVN) and click “Next.” This step ensures accurate identification and verification of the applicants’ bank accounts.
  4. Enter their National Identification Number (NIN) and click “Next.” The NIN is a unique identification number issued by the National Identity Management Commission (NIMC) in Nigeria.
  5. Enter the bank account details that were submitted during the Npower registration process. This includes selecting the name of their bank (e.g., First Bank, United Bank of Africa, Guarantee Trust Bank, Access Bank, etc.), inputting the 11-digit bank account number, and observing the automatic appearance of the account name in green color. Once all details are entered correctly, the applicants can click “Next.”
  6. Review the entered data for accuracy and click “Submit.” It is essential to ensure that all details are correctly provided, as submitted data cannot be changed or resubmitted after this step.

Important reminders

Applicants should be aware of the following important points during the process:

  • Pay close attention to the authenticity of the text messages received. The provided messages are confirmed to be genuine and official communications from NASIMS.
  • The two links, validation.nasims.ng and http://kir.am/6/02KD5tPotHCl, are identical and lead to the Npower Validation Link, validation.nasims.ng/validation, which facilitates the update of bank account details for unpaid Npower beneficiaries.
  • Accurately input all necessary information during the confirmation and validation process, including the Npower ID, BVN, NIN, and bank account details.
  • Once the updated details are submitted, no further changes can be made or resubmitted. Therefore, it is crucial to avoid any mistakes during the data entry.
